React testing library waitfor click

WebAug 14, 2024 · The wait utilities retry until the query passes or times out. The async methods return a Promise, so you must always use await or .then (done) when calling them. 1. … WebThe npm package @testing-library/react receives a total of 5,599,800 downloads a week. As such, we scored @testing-library/react popularity level to be Key ecosystem project. Based on project statistics from the GitHub repository for the npm package @testing-library/react, we found that it has been starred 17,684 times.

Example Testing Library

WebApr 12, 2024 · Логотип react-testing-library Эта библиотека даёт разработчику простые инструменты, построенные на базе react-dom и react-dom/test-utild, причём, библиотека устроена так, чтобы тот, кто пользуется ей, без особых проблем применял бы в своей ... WebJan 14, 2024 · Sorted by: 40. If you're waiting for appearance, you can use it like this: it ('increments counter after 0.5s', async () => { const { getByTestId, getByText } = render … bis warrior tank wrath https://hirschfineart.com

React Testing Library waitFor: Start Using It in 6 Steps

WebCheck React-modal_module 0.1.4 package - Last release 0.1.4 at our NPM packages aggregator and search engine. WebJul 15, 2024 · There are two ways to do this, both involving react-testing-library 's async helper function waitFor. The first and simpler method is to wait until something else happens in your document before checking that the element doesn't exist: WebFeb 4, 2024 · Testing click event in React Testing Library. Here is a simple subcomponent that reveals an answer to a question when the button is clicked: const Question = ( { … bis war tank bc classic

Example Testing Library

Category:How to wait to assert an element never appears in the document?

Tags:React testing library waitfor click

React testing library waitfor click

Branch details - Prince George

WebJan 27, 2024 · The general rule of thumb of using await findBy query and await waitFor is that you should use await findBy when you expect an element to appear but the change to the DOM might not happen immediately. and await waitFor when you have a unit test that mocks API calls and you need to wait for your mock promises to resolve. WebOpinionated library for Test-Driven Development of React Components. GitHub. MIT. Latest version published 5 months ago. Package Health Score 67 / 100. Full package analysis. ... test-drive-react.simulate.click; test-drive-react.simulate.focus; test-drive-react.simulate.input; test-drive-react.simulate.keyDown;

React testing library waitfor click

Did you know?

WebApr 12, 2024 · To use React's Testing Library, you need to install it as a dependency in your project. If you created your project using create-react-app or bit dev, this library comes pre-installed. To install manually, you can do this by running the following command in your terminal: npm install -D @testing-library/react @testing-library/jest-dom @testing ... WebUsing Jest and React Testing libraries, unit testing can be conducted on JavaScript files. Jest - Jest is a testing platform capable of adapting to any JavaScript library or framework, designed to ensure the correctness of any JavaScript codebase. Jest and React Testing Libraries are used in conjunction for unit testing.

WebSoftware Engineer (ReactJS, NextJS, Typescript, GraphQL, Apollo-Client, Jest/React Testing Library/Cypress) 1y Edited WebAug 14, 2024 · The wait utilities retry until the query passes or times out. The async methods return a Promise, so you must always use await or .then (done) when calling them. 1. Using findBy Queries test('movie title appears', async () => { const movie = await findByText('the lion king') }) 2. Using waitFor test('movie title appears', async () => {

WebApr 30, 2024 · Before assertions, wait for component update to fully complete by using waitFor. waitFor is an API provided by React testing library to wait for the wrapped assertions to pass within a... WebLet’s introduce the waitFor () function to fix this test. In Thought.test.js import waitFor from @testing-library/react 2. Use waitFor () to assert that this thought will eventually be removed from the DOM. Your callback should be written using arrow-function syntax.

WebJun 2, 2024 · waitFor, } from '@testing-library/dom' // adds special assertions like toHaveTextContent import '@testing-library/jest-dom' function getExampleDOM() { // This is just a raw example of setting up some DOM // that we can interact with. Swap this with your UI // framework of choice 😉 const div = document.createElement('div') div.innerHTML = `

WebJavascript 如何测试连接的组件以及测试组件的内容?,javascript,reactjs,react-redux,jestjs,react-testing-library,Javascript,Reactjs,React Redux,Jestjs,React Testing Library darty neff b57cr22n0WebNov 21, 2024 · testing-library/await-async-utils makes sure you are awaiting for async methods like waitFor and waitForElementToBeRemoved testing-library/await-async-query … biswarup syam cortland nyhttp://duoduokou.com/javascript/50837562316678318709.html darty neracWebDec 21, 2024 · Here's where to find COVID-19 testing sites in Prince George's County as the number of COVID-19 cases continues to rise before the holidays. biswas baral myrepublicaWebimport { waitFor } from '@testing-library/react'; As with the other async functions, the waitFor() function returns a Promise, so we have to preface its call with the await … biswas abhishekWebsusan calman campervan make and model → mit acceptance for recruited athletes → react testing library waitfor timeout . react testing library waitfor timeoutmetaphors for hiding emotions Posted by on April 8, 2024 ... darty neufchâtel en bray 76270Webgitlabhq / gitlabhq / spec / frontend / pipelines / graph_shared / links_layer_spec.js View on Github darty neufchatel en bray horaires